Simplify LinkstateGraphBuilder.getLinkAttributes() 71/96971/1
authorRobert Varga <robert.varga@pantheon.tech>
Tue, 20 Jul 2021 18:09:17 +0000 (20:09 +0200)
committerRobert Varga <robert.varga@pantheon.tech>
Wed, 21 Jul 2021 12:29:36 +0000 (14:29 +0200)
commitdce3888f0cb1e748420a24362834b866b997d91d
tree31c5c3de1c76e5dd41bdb8afb2e273edefadc2d6
parentebcf438cc3660970bcd63722cc7d34f7a59fb33c
Simplify LinkstateGraphBuilder.getLinkAttributes()

If have too many if/else statements here and a blind cast. Refactor
checks and use a simple return.

Change-Id: I158914f2e972f5f0265438f51eb287076b436459
Signed-off-by: Robert Varga <robert.varga@pantheon.tech>
(cherry picked from commit 5d3825f545a15b19ef8d0f20730f2c4e3528dfa7)
bgp/topology-provider/src/main/java/org/opendaylight/bgpcep/bgp/topology/provider/LinkstateGraphBuilder.java